Transaction 585f4033551ee1890f5ab4c5bd2c850bc5ea256f25285153d05e2745db04db48

1 Input
2 Outputs
  • 585f4033551ee1890f5ab4c5bd2c850bc5ea256f25285153d05e2745db04db48:0
  • value  579883
    address  3LTazmWE6YVkmSkHsV7uZPGc5dt2F71zSz
  • 585f4033551ee1890f5ab4c5bd2c850bc5ea256f25285153d05e2745db04db48:1
  • value  30129462
    address  3H9xmmmBmZ9rMYpfXYF4bE5G9JRFFvBnXR